Visão Geral

Description

The MPX2100DP is a differential pressure sensor designed for applications requiring accurate pressure measurement. It belongs to the MPX2100 series of sensors and is commonly used in various fields, including automotive, medical, and industrial sectors. The sensor can measure pressure differences between two points, making it ideal for monitoring fluid levels, flow rates, and other pressure-related parameters.
Key features of the MPX2100DP include a high-sensitivity piezoresistive transducer, a linear output voltage proportional to the applied pressure, and a robust design that ensures durability and precision. It typically operates over a pressure range of 0 to 100 kPa (0 to 14.5 psi) and can handle both positive and negative differential pressures.
The sensor is available in a dual-port configuration, allowing it to measure the pressure difference between two separate chambers. Its small size and reliable performance make it suitable for integration into compact systems. Overall, the MPX2100DP provides a reliable solution for precise pressure monitoring in diverse applications.

Frequently Asked Questions


Q: What is the typical output voltage range of the MPX2100DP at full scale pressure?
A: The output is 0 mV to 40 mV (typical) with a 10V supply at 14.5 PSI differential pressure.


Q: Can the MPX2100DP be used for absolute pressure measurements?
A: No, this sensor has a Differential pressure type; it requires two pressure ports for comparing pressures.


Q: What is the maximum pressure this sensor can withstand without damage?
A: The maximum overpressure rating is 58.02 PSI (400kPa), exceeding the operating range.


Q: Does this sensor require an external amplifier for signal output?
A: Yes, the 0-40 mV unamplified Wheatstone bridge output typically needs an external amplifier or ADC.


Q: What is the recommended supply voltage for stable operation?
A: The operating voltage range is 10V to 16V, with 10V being the typical excitation for rated output.


Q: Is the MPX2100DP temperature compensated for accurate readings?
A: Yes, it features Temperature Compensated output for stable performance across -40°C to 125°C.


Q: What mounting and port style does this sensor use?
A: It uses Through Hole mounting with PC pins and dual 0.19" barbed ports for tube connections.
